How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Leland?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 28451 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,948 | $982 | $8,542 |
| 28451 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,094 | $1,129 | $5,769 |
| 28451 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,370 | $2,195 | $2,829 |

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 28451?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 28451 range from $1,129 to $5,769,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,129 to $5,769.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,195 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,195.
